制图图纸的标识方法及标识装置、电子设备、存储介质制造方法及图纸

技术编号:33143093 阅读:14 留言:0更新日期:2022-04-22 13:54
本发明专利技术公开了一种制图图纸的标识方法及标识装置、电子设备、存储介质。其中,该标识方法包括:接收待审查的制图图纸,并遍历制图图纸中的三视图信息;基于三视图信息,构建三维图形;识别三维图形中的每个图形特征;在图形特征的三视图信息出现错误的情况下,对制图图纸中出现错误的三视图信息进行标识。本发明专利技术解决了相关技术中通过将图纸中的对象属性与标准进行比较,只能检查出图纸出现的格式错误,无法识别出图纸图形特征的错误的技术问题。无法识别出图纸图形特征的错误的技术问题。无法识别出图纸图形特征的错误的技术问题。

【技术实现步骤摘要】
制图图纸的标识方法及标识装置、电子设备、存储介质


[0001]本专利技术涉及图纸处理
,具体而言,涉及一种制图图纸的标识方法及标识装置、电子设备、存储介质。

技术介绍

[0002]相关技术中,在通过制图软件(例如,CAD软件)完成图纸后,需要审查图纸制作内容是否出现错误,当复杂的图纸绘制完成之后,有些细节往往容易被忽视,比如绘制过程中的少线或多线问题、尺寸标注错误等,这时候图纸如果直接交付审查,有可能会出现很多的问题,需要多次修改,导致后续项目交付进程时间较长。
[0003]现有的图纸错误审查方法,大部分是遍历图纸中的检查对象属性,然后与标准进行比较来判断错误。但是通过将图纸中对象属性与标准进行比较,只能检查出图纸出现的格式错误(比如线宽、字体字号不正确等),无法识别出图纸对象特征的错误(例如,多线或少线、曲线绘制错误、标注缺少或多余等错误)。
[0004]针对上述的问题,目前尚未提出有效的解决方案。

技术实现思路

[0005]本专利技术实施例提供了一种制图图纸的标识方法及标识装置、电子设备、存储介质,以至少解决相关技术中通过将图纸中的对象属性与标准进行比较,只能检查出图纸出现的格式错误,无法识别出图纸图形特征的错误的技术问题。
[0006]根据本专利技术实施例的一个方面,提供了一种制图图纸的标识方法,包括:接收待审查的制图图纸,并遍历所述制图图纸中的三视图信息;基于所述三视图信息,构建三维图形;识别所述三维图形中的每个图形特征;在所述图形特征的三视图信息出现错误的情况下,对所述制图图纸中出现错误的三视图信息进行标识。
[0007]可选地,基于所述三视图信息,构建三维图形的步骤,包括:分别采用三个视图识别所述制图图纸中的对象圆、轮廓曲线和内部环路曲线;遍历所述对象圆,得到与所述对象圆对应的图形特征的几何要素,并分别在三个视图中将所述对象圆对应的曲线标记为特征曲线;遍历所述轮廓曲线,得到与所述轮廓曲线对应的所述图形特征的几何要素,并分别在三个视图中将所述轮廓曲线对应的曲线标记为特征曲线;遍历所述内部环路曲线,得到与所述内部环路曲线对应的所述图形特征的几何要素,并分别在三个视图中将所述内部环路曲线对应的曲线标记为特征曲线;将无标记的图纸曲线进行重组,并采用三个视图组成至少一个凸台特征,记录与所述凸台特征对应的图形特征的几何要素;综合所有的特征曲线和每个图形特征的几何要素,构建携带图形特征的所述三维图形。
[0008]可选地,遍历所述对象圆,得到与所述对象圆对应的图形特征的几何要素的步骤,包括:以所述三个视图的任意一个视图为基准,遍历所述对象圆,并从另外两个视图中查找所述对象圆对应的曲线;在所述曲线包围的内部无剖面线且所述对象圆内无剖面线的情况下,确定所述对象圆对应的图形特征为孔特征;在所述曲线包围的内部有剖面线,和/或,所
述对象圆内有剖面线的情况下,确定所述对象圆对应的图形特征为圆柱特征;记录所述孔特征和所述圆柱特征的几何要素。
[0009]可选地,遍历所述轮廓曲线,得到与所述轮廓曲线对应的所述图形特征的几何要素的步骤,包括:遍历所述轮廓曲线,根据凹凸性查找所述轮廓曲线中的凹曲线组合;遍历所述凹曲线组合,确定所述轮廓曲线对应的图形特征为槽特征;记录所述槽特征的几何要素。
[0010]可选地,遍历所述内部环路曲线,得到与所述内部环路曲线对应的所述图形特征的几何要素的步骤,包括:在采用三个视图的任意一个视图遍历得到所述内部环路曲线,且另外两个视图中的对应曲线内部无剖面线的情况下,确定所述内部环路曲线对应的所述图形特征为槽特征;记录所述槽特征的几何要素。
[0011]可选地,所述图形特征的三视图信息包括:特征曲线、线条类型和特征标注,其中,所述特征标注用于标注所述图形特征或者所述图形特征的位置。
[0012]可选地,在识别所述三维图形中的每个图形特征之后,所述标识方法还包括:将所述图形特征的特征曲线与预设图形库中的三视图进行对比,得到比较结果,其中,所述比较结果用于指示所述制图图纸中的图形特征的特征曲线绘制是否正确;分别在三个视图中检测所述特征标注是否准确,得到检测结果。
[0013]可选地,在所述图形特征的三视图信息出现错误的情况下,对所述制图图纸中出现错误的三视图信息进行标识的步骤,包括:在所述图形特征的特征曲线绘制错误的情况下,采用第一颜色在所述制图图纸中标识绘制错误的所述特征曲线;在所述图形特征的特征标注出现错误的情况下,采用第二颜色在所述制图图纸中标识错误的所述特征标注。
[0014]根据本专利技术实施例的另一方面,还提供了一种制图图纸的标识装置,包括:遍历单元,用于接收待审查的制图图纸,并遍历所述制图图纸中的三视图信息;构建单元,用于基于所述三视图信息,构建三维图形;识别单元,用于识别所述三维图形中的每个图形特征;标识单元,用于在所述图形特征的三视图信息出现错误的情况下,对所述制图图纸中出现错误的三视图信息进行标识。
[0015]可选地,所述构建单元包括:第一识别模块,用于分别采用三个视图识别所述制图图纸中的对象圆、轮廓曲线和内部环路曲线;第一遍历模块,用于遍历所述对象圆,得到与所述对象圆对应的图形特征的几何要素,并分别在三个视图中将所述对象圆对应的曲线标记为特征曲线;第二遍历模块,用于遍历所述轮廓曲线,得到与所述轮廓曲线对应的所述图形特征的几何要素,并分别在三个视图中将所述轮廓曲线对应的曲线标记为特征曲线;第三遍历模块,用于遍历所述内部环路曲线,得到与所述内部环路曲线对应的所述图形特征的几何要素,并分别在三个视图中将所述内部环路曲线对应的曲线标记为特征曲线;第一记录模块,用于将无标记的图纸曲线进行重组,并采用三个视图组成至少一个凸台特征,记录与所述凸台特征对应的图形特征的几何要素;第一构建模块,用于综合所有的特征曲线和每个图形特征的几何要素,构建携带图形特征的所述三维图形。
[0016]可选地,所述第一遍历模块包括:第一遍历子模块,用于以所述三个视图的任意一个视图为基准,遍历所述对象圆,并从另外两个视图中查找所述对象圆对应的曲线;第一确定子模块,用于在所述曲线包围的内部无剖面线且所述对象圆内无剖面线的情况下,确定所述对象圆对应的图形特征为孔特征;第二确定子模块,用于在所述曲线包围的内部有剖
面线,和/或,所述对象圆内有剖面线的情况下,确定所述对象圆对应的图形特征为圆柱特征;第一记录子模块,用于记录所述孔特征和所述圆柱特征的几何要素。
[0017]可选地,所述第二遍历模块,包括:第二遍历子模块,用于遍历所述轮廓曲线,根据凹凸性查找所述轮廓曲线中的凹曲线组合;第三确定历子模块,用于遍历所述凹曲线组合,确定所述轮廓曲线对应的图形特征为槽特征;第二记录子模块,用于记录所述槽特征的几何要素。
[0018]可选地,所述第三遍历模块,包括:第四确定子模块,用于在采用三个视图的任意一个视图遍历得到所述内部环路曲线,且另外两个视图中的对应曲线内部无剖面线的情况下,确定所述内部环路曲线对应的所述图形特征为槽特征;第三记录子本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种制图图纸的标识方法,其特征在于,包括:接收待审查的制图图纸,并遍历所述制图图纸中的三视图信息;基于所述三视图信息,构建三维图形;识别所述三维图形中的每个图形特征;在所述图形特征的三视图信息出现错误的情况下,对所述制图图纸中出现错误的三视图信息进行标识。2.根据权利要求1所述的标识方法,其特征在于,基于所述三视图信息,构建三维图形的步骤,包括:分别采用三个视图识别所述制图图纸中的对象圆、轮廓曲线和内部环路曲线;遍历所述对象圆,得到与所述对象圆对应的图形特征的几何要素,并分别在三个视图中将所述对象圆对应的曲线标记为特征曲线;遍历所述轮廓曲线,得到与所述轮廓曲线对应的所述图形特征的几何要素,并分别在三个视图中将所述轮廓曲线对应的曲线标记为特征曲线;遍历所述内部环路曲线,得到与所述内部环路曲线对应的所述图形特征的几何要素,并分别在三个视图中将所述内部环路曲线对应的曲线标记为特征曲线;将无标记的图纸曲线进行重组,并采用三个视图组成至少一个凸台特征,记录与所述凸台特征对应的图形特征的几何要素;综合所有的特征曲线和每个图形特征的几何要素,构建携带图形特征的所述三维图形。3.根据权利要求2所述的标识方法,其特征在于,遍历所述对象圆,得到与所述对象圆对应的图形特征的几何要素的步骤,包括:以所述三个视图的任意一个视图为基准,遍历所述对象圆,并从另外两个视图中查找所述对象圆对应的曲线;在所述曲线包围的内部无剖面线且所述对象圆内无剖面线的情况下,确定所述对象圆对应的图形特征为孔特征;在所述曲线包围的内部有剖面线,和/或,所述对象圆内有剖面线的情况下,确定所述对象圆对应的图形特征为圆柱特征;记录所述孔特征和所述圆柱特征的几何要素。4.根据权利要求2所述的标识方法,其特征在于,遍历所述轮廓曲线,得到与所述轮廓曲线对应的所述图形特征的几何要素的步骤,包括:遍历所述轮廓曲线,根据凹凸性查找所述轮廓曲线中的凹曲线组合;遍历所述凹曲线组合,确定所述轮廓曲线对应的图形特征为槽特征;记录所述槽特征的几何要素。5.根据权利要求2所述的标识方法,其特征在于,遍历所述内部环路曲线,得到与所...

【专利技术属性】
技术研发人员:许林林
申请(专利权)人:北京数码大方科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1